Improved syndrome decoding of lifted L-interleaved Gabidulin codes

摘要

A syndrome decoding algorithm for lifted interleaved Gabidulin codes of order L is proposed. The algorithm corrects L times more deviations (packet insertions) than known syndrome decoding methods with probability at least 1-8q-n, where n is the length of the (interleaved) Gabidulin code. For nL, the proposed scheme has L times less computational complexity than known interpolation-factorization based decoders which attain the same decoding region. Upper bounds on the decoding failure probability are derived. Up to our knowledge this is the first syndrome-based scheme for interleaved subspace codes that can correct deviations beyond the unique decoding radius.
